Summary

Ezequiel Durán and Elias Díaz each hit solo home runs, and Cal Quantrill delivered a strong performance with six scoreless innings as the Texas Rangers defeated the Los Angeles Angels 5-3 on Sunday. Durán opened the scoring with his 14th home run of the season. The Rangers extended their lead with an RBI triple from Cody Freeman and Díaz's sixth home run in the fifth inning. Quantrill's pitching allowed only six hits, striking out six without issuing a walk, marking his fifth consecutive start allowing one run or fewer. The Angels rallied in the eighth inning with a home run from Zach Neto, but managed only three runs overall.

By the Numbers
  • Rangers move to 65-66, tying Astros for AL West lead.
  • Quantrill improves to 6-4, extending scoreless innings streak to 15.
  • Neto's eighth-inning homer sparked Angels' limited offense.
  • Angels' Yusei Kikuchi allows five runs over five innings.
  • Rangers face the White Sox in Chicago on Monday.
